Bandırma - Bursa - Osmaneli high standard railway is a 201 kilometer long high standard railway project planned to be built between Bandırma Station in Balıkesir and Osmaneli YHT Station in Bilecik.

The 105-kilometer section of the High Standard Railway line between Bursa and Osmaneli is currently under construction, and this section is planned to be put into service in 2023. There is currently no information regarding the construction of the remaining part. When the line is completed, it will be integrated with the Ankara - Istanbul high speed railway line and will connect Bursa to Ankara, Istanbul and Izmir.

The line is built for a speed of 250 kilometers. However, even high-speed passenger trains are planned to run at a maximum speed of 200 kilometers / hour (120 mph) and freight trains at a maximum speed of 100 kilometers / hour (62 mph). During the construction of the line, 13 million cubic meters of excavation, 10 million cubic meters of filling will be carried out and a total of 152 works of art will be built. Approximately 43 kilometers of the line will consist of tunnels, viaducts and bridges.

YSE Yapı-Tepe İnşaat joint venture will realize the infrastructure of the 105-kilometer-long section between Bursa and Yenişehir, which will be connected to the Ankara-Istanbul line from Bilecik, until 75. The application projects of the 393-kilometer Yenişehir - Osmaneli section have been completed. Its tender was held at the beginning of 2015. On 30 December 2012, the foundation was laid in a ceremony attended by Deputy Prime Minister Bülent Arınç, Minister of Transport, Maritime Affairs and Communications Binali Yıldırım, Minister of Labor and Social Security Faruk Çelik and General Director of TCDD Süleyman Karaman.

However, in the past 9 years, the process could not be completed due to the change of the route due to the earthquake risk, the problems experienced in expropriation, and the reconstruction of the projects. Finally, in August 2020, the tender for the 201-kilometer Bandırma-Bursa-Yenişehir-Osmaneli High Standard Railway Line Construction and the Supply of Electromechanical Systems was made by the Ministry of Transport, Infrastructure Investments, and Kalyon Construction won the tender for 9 billion 449 million TL. The tender included a 95-kilometer Bursa-Bandırma line, a 56-kilometer Bursa-Yenişehir line and a 50-kilometer Yenişehir-Osmaneli line. Kalyon Construction started the construction of a construction site in an area of ​​approximately 50 thousand square meters in the vicinity of Yenişehir Ebeköy in order to start work on the 45-kilometer Yenişehir-Osmaneli line.
